One glaring example came from Rep. Ayanna Pressley (D-MA), who managed to connect supporters of President Donald Trump’s ‘Make America Great Again’ movement with the 19th-century Democrats who would rather split up the nation than give up their slaves.

As Breitbart reported:

Pressley made the remarks Monday at Roxbury Community College in Boston while campaigning for Sen. Ed Markey (D-MA) in his primary race against Rep. Seth Moulton (D-MA).

“It is bigger than Trump,” Pressley said. “Because whenever we do the work of ousting the occupant of the Oval Office, the Confederacy is still alive and well. That’s all MAGA is.”

“White supremacy is still alive and well,” she continued. “Anti-blackness will still be alive and well.”

Markey is seeking another term in the Senate but faces a Democrat primary challenge from Moulton. Pressley endorsed Markey in March after previously considering a Senate campaign of her own.
